Sausage Burrito

Sausage Burrito

The Sausage Burrito is one of the most popular breakfast items on the McDonald's menu. It contains scrambled eggs, pork sausage, diced onions, and green peppers, all wrapped in a soft tortilla. The Sausage Burrito has 300 calories, 16g of fat, 21g of carbohydrates, and 12g of protein. If you are looking for a quick breakfast in the morning, this burrito can be a great option.

Steak and Egg Burrito

Steak And Egg Burrito

The Steak and Egg Burrito is a new addition to the McDonald's breakfast menu. It contains seasoned steak, scrambled eggs, fire-roasted peppers and onions, shredded cheddar cheese, and a creamy jalapeno sauce, all wrapped in a soft tortilla. The Steak and Egg Burrito has 430 calories, 23g of fat, 32g of carbohydrates, and 22g of protein.
